UFC news UFC 265 Weigh-in Results Lewis outweighs Gane

The official weigh-in ceremony of UFC 265 participants took place at the Toyota Center Arena in Houston, the main event of which will be the fight for the interim heavyweight title between Derrick Lewis and Cyril Gane.

The American fighter was almost 8 kilograms (17.5 pounds) heavier than the Frenchman, showing 119.7 kg (264.5 pounds) on the scales.

Of the 26 fighters that stepped to the scale at Friday’s official weigh-ins, the lone miss was Manel Kape, the No. 13 flyweight in the MMA Fighting Rankings.

UFC 265 Weigh-in Results

Main Card (ESPN+ pay-per-view at 10 p.m. ET)

Derrick Lewis (264.5) vs Ciryl Gane (247)

Jose Aldo (136) vs Pedro Munhoz (135)

Michael Chiesa (170.5) vs Vicente Luque (170)

Tecia Torres (115) vs. Angela Hill (115)

Song Yadong (135.5) vs. Casey Kenney (136)

Preliminary Card (ESPN2, ESPN+ at 8 p.m. ET)

Bobby Green (156) vs. Rafael Fiziev (155.5)

Vince Morales (136) vs. Drako Rodriguez (136)

Alonzo Menifield (204.5) vs. Ed Herman (205.5)

Karolina Kowalkiewicz (115) vs. Jessica Penne (116)

Early Prelims (ESPN2, ESPN+ at 6 p.m. ET)

Manel Kape (129)* vs. Ode Osbourne (125)

Miles Johns (136) vs. Anderson dos Santos (135.5)

Victoria Leonardo (125) vs. Melissa Gatto (124)

Johnny Munoz (135.5) vs. Jamey Simmons (136)

*Kape missed weight. His bout with Ode Osbourne will proceed at a catchweight with Kape forfeiting 20 percent of his purse to Osbourne.
